George Harrison
has an amazing family tree that goes way back to the
13th century when the Harrison's ancestors, who were
Norman Knights from France, settled in Southern Ireland.
George Harrison
was born on 25th February 1943 at 12 Arnold Grove,
in the Wavertree area of Liverpool, to Louise and
Harold Harrison. The new baby had two brothers, Peter
